Abstract

Differential space-time modulation (DSTM) for multiple antenna communication systems has been recently proposed for frequency-nonselective fading channels. In broadband multirate systems, frequency-selective fading may occur. In this paper, the DSTM in frequency-selective fading channels is considered. A linear equalizer for the DSTM is proposed over frequency-selective fading channels. Furthermore, the multiple symbol decision feedback detection is used to improve the performance of the linear equalizer.
